Chet Holmgren OVER 24.5 Points, Rebounds & Assists

Chet Holmgren has been very impressive throughout the playoffs. Shai Gilgeous-Alexander might get a lot of the credit when they win, and for good reason, but Holmgren can certainly hold his own when it matters most.

He’s been a stable force for this team in every category, including points, rebounds, and assists. Holmgren has had at least 25 PRA in three of his past four games, and he’s not showing any signs of slowing down now.

The Wolves don’t have much of an answer for him on defense, and for that reason, we’re taking the over on his PRA total until he puts up a bad night. 

Shai Gilgeous-Alexander OVER 8.5 Made Three Throws

We hate to call him the free-throw merchant, but if the shoe fits… Shai Gilgeous-Alexander has made at least nine free throws in three of four games this series, putting up double-digit numbers in those three games.

He finds ways to get to the line, and because he shot nearly 90% from the line during the regular season, we’re betting that he’ll have another big night from the line. NBA fans might not like it, but it’s the reality of his game.
